Dining Events at Dino
Truffle Dinner
Sunday November 16, 2007
The second annual truffle dinner at Dino will offer 7 courses, 5 of
which will feature the white truffle and two which will contain either black
or burgundy truffles, depending
on which is in season.
Highlights of the menu include the classic Risotto with
White truffle,
Scallop in the Shell with a Black or Burgundy Truffle Butter Sauce,
Wild
Boar Strip Loin with a Red Wine Sauce & White Truffles. There will
be
two wine flights available, Damned Good for $49 and Even Better for
$99.

Dino's Happy Hour
As much as dino is known for its wine menu, we are also proud of our
innovative, artisan bar selections. Dino would like to now introduce
our new Bar Manager, one of DC's premiere drink makers, Scott Palmer.
Scott is also a food fanatic and has, so far, been a wonderful addition
to Dino.
Starting Sunday October 26, every Sunday thru Friday
from 5:30 to 7:00pm we will offer our Italian style happy hour. Every
3 or more food items will be available for your snacking pleasure complements
of Dino. These will include house made pates and
sausages, crostini with assorted toppings, salumi and cheeses just as
you would find during "l'ora d'aperitivi" at some of our favorite bars
in Italy (especially Bar alle Logge in Montalcino)! Also offered is a 25% discount
on all spirits and wine purchased during
the happy hour, including Five Families {An Italian spin on the Manhattan} as
well as Dino favorites.

Catania Bakery
1404 N. Capitol St., DC 20002
202-332-5135
cataniabakery.com
Supplying bread and biscotti to many of DC's finest Italian restaurants,
the Catania Bakery is open to retail customers on Saturdays from 6AM to
1PM and serves up some of the best croissants and pastries in the District. But
be sure to get there early because they often sell out before noon!

Mangialardo & Sons Inc. Italian Deli
1317 Pennsylvania Ave. SE, DC 20003
202-543-6212
This old-fashioned carryout sub shop and deli has been doing business
since the 1950s. Tony Mangialardo (owner) and his crew only accept
cash, but the 8-inch sub you get for less than $7 is worth it.
